Antique George IV Hallmarked Sterling Silver Fiddle Pattern Dessert Spoon 1829

£75.00

YEAR OF MANUFACTURE: 1829
ORIGIN: London, England
MAKER: Morris & Michael Emanuel, London, active circa 1825-1830
WEIGHT: 1.93 troy ounces (2.12 ounces or 60.00 grams)
STOCK CODE: W042015

Featured Crests

  

Item Description

This Georgian fiddle pattern dessert spoon weighs as much as many tablespoons! It is in beautiful condition and shows minimal signs of wear.

Length: 18.5cm (7 1/4 inches)
